IMPORTED STRUCTURAL PLYWOOD PRODUCTS

Legislation

Buildings and structures must comply with the performance requirements of the BCA. The performance requirements of Volume 2 of the BCA that address structural stability and resistance to actions are contained in P2.1.
Structural plywood that complies with AS/NZS 2269:2004 Plywood – Structural satisfies P2.1. AS/NZS 2269:2004 specifies requirements for the manufacture, grading, finishing and branding of structural plywood as well as the bonding (refer to clause 3.3) between plies.

New Modern Homes standards

The National Construction Code (NCC) 2022 commenced on 1 May 2023. In Queensland, the Modern Homes standards included in NCC 2022 will be introduced in a phased approach: The new Modern Homes accessibility standards will be phased in from 1 October 2023. The new Modern Homes energy efficiency standards will commence on 1 May 2024.
